Do you mean you left it for the night, and then the next day the watch stopped? I don't really understand the first part of your explanation because there is no mention of pushing the top pusher to start the chronograph. If the chrono hands are not at 12, if you wind the watch they should start moving. There is no hidden tricks to it. It the watch stopped, you still hit the top pusher, before hitting the bottom to reset. Wind it to see if they move, and if so, top pusher to stop time, and bottom to reset. |

The most obvious answer is that you aren't pressing the pushers hard enough - if the chrono hands aren't moving then either pusher should work but the bottom one will reset them so try pushing harder (you won't break it). The other possibility is that because you didn't buy from an AD the watch was a customer return that got fobbed off on the grey market (Costco) in which case returning it is the only option because you have no Breitling warranty. |
